Why Good Roofing Matters for Every Property
A roof is one of the most hard-working parts of any building. It faces changing weather conditions throughout the year, including heavy rain, strong winds, cold temperatures and seasonal heat. Over the years, tiles can crack, mortar can wear away, flashing may lift and guttering can block up or suffer damage. These issues may seem small at first, but they can quickly allow moisture to enter the structure. If water enters the property, it can impact ceilings, insulation, timber, plaster and electrical fittings. Qualified Roofers Huntingdon understand how to assess these faults carefully and put the right fixes in place before they become serious.
A solid roof also helps maintain comfort and energy efficiency. Gaps, damaged felt, missing tiles or poor ventilation can let heat escape and encourage damp. As a result, the property can be more difficult to heat and less comfortable through winter. Good roofing is not just about repairing visible faults; it is also about safeguarding the entire structure. Common Roof Repairs in Huntingdon
Many property owners seek Roof Repairs Huntingdon when they notice ceiling stains, damp patches, loose tiles, overflowing gutters or visible storm damage. Typical repair work includes replacing broken tiles, stopping leaks, repairing ridge tiles, renewing flashing, sealing valleys, improving flat roof sections and resolving chimney-related issues. Each repair should be handled with care because roofing problems are often connected. A leak in one section may be caused by damage somewhere else, so a thorough inspection matters.
Experienced roofers do more than patch the obvious fault. They examine the surrounding areas, assess the materials and look for any hidden weaknesses. This approach helps prevent repeat problems and gives the property owner greater confidence in the repair. Whether it is a small tiled repair or more comprehensive weatherproofing, professional care can help prolong the roof’s lifespan and reduce future upkeep costs.
